首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
如下函数的作用是以双倍行距输出文件: void double—space(ifstream&f,ofstream&t){ char c; whilc(______){ __________ if(c==‘\n’)t.
如下函数的作用是以双倍行距输出文件: void double—space(ifstream&f,ofstream&t){ char c; whilc(______){ __________ if(c==‘\n’)t.
admin
2014-08-29
52
问题
如下函数的作用是以双倍行距输出文件:
void double—space(ifstream&f,ofstream&t){
char c;
whilc(______){
__________
if(c==‘\n’)t.put(c);
)
}
画线处缺失的部分是( )。
选项
A、f.get(c)与t.put(c)
B、f.put(c)与t.get(c)
C、t.get(c)与f.put(c)
D、t.put(c)与f.get(c)
答案
A
解析
此题考查的是文件流。get()函数作用是读入一个字符,所以调用它的应该是输入文件流ifstream对象f.put()函数作用是输出一个字符,所以调用它的应该是输入文件流ofstream对象t,故选项B、C排除。读入和输出应该是有顺序的,应该先读入后输出,所以前一空填fget(c),后一空填t.put(c)。
转载请注明原文地址:https://www.kaotiyun.com/show/pXNp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下面程序的输出结果是()。#include<iostream>usingnamespacestd;classA{public:A(){cout<<"A";}}class
下列程序的运行结果为()。#include<iostream>usingnamespacestd;namespacem{intflag=10;}namespacen{
以下选项中,不能正确赋值的是()。
若结构Arith中有一成员定义为char*op;,另有结构指针p定义为Arith*p=newArith.,则要访问p所指对象中的。p成员所指向的对象,应使用表达式【】。
定义重载函数时,应在参数个数或参数类型上【】。
排序是计算机程序设计中的一种重要操作,常见的排序方法有插入排序、【】和选择排序等。
下面是一个栈类的模板,其中push函数将元素i压入栈顶,pop函数弹出栈顶元素。栈初始为空,top值为0,栈顶元素在stack[top-1)中,在下面横线处填上适当语句,完成栈类模板的定义。template<classT>class
在重载一个运算符时,如果其参数表中有一个参数,则说明该运算符是
以下选项中合法的用户标识符是
数据流图中带有箭头的线段表示的是( )。
随机试题
痰火扰神的主要症状有
慢性胃窦胃炎的临床表现为
肠结核的好发部位是
涎石病的临床特点
测定蛋白样品中某种分子量的蛋白选用最佳的方法是
对于钢筋力学性能检验时,同一牌号、同一炉罐号、同一规格、同一等级、同一交货状态的钢筋,每批不大于()t。
心理活动表现在强度、速度、稳定性和灵活性等方面动力性质的心理特征叫()
社会主义初级阶段的起点是()。
What’sthelengthofthebridgeacrosstheMavudayerRiver?
Labelthemapbelow.Writethecorrectletter,A-E,nexttoquestions11-15.CarPark
最新回复
(
0
)